Description

Spraying device of high-hardness writing board
Technical Field
The utility model relates to a spraying technical field of high rigidity clipboard specifically is a spraying device of high rigidity clipboard.
Background
The writing board has the functions of one board with multiple purposes, has the main functions of projection, dust-free writing and the like, and is mainly used for teaching;
the existing spraying device is easy to shake during moving due to the fact that the high-hardness writing board is thin, and then the spraying effect is poor;
therefore, the spraying device for the high-hardness writing board is provided to solve the problem that the existing spraying device is easy to shake during moving and then poor in spraying effect.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ative efforts all belong to the protection scope of the present invention.
Referring to fig. 1-4, a spraying device for a high-hardness writing board comprises a main body mechanism 1, wherein an auxiliary mechanism 2 is fixedly connected above the main body mechanism 1;
the main body mechanism 1 comprises a rack 101, wherein rolling shafts 102 are movably connected to the left side and the right side of the rack 101, a motor 103 is connected to the front end of the rack 101 through screws, a conveying belt 104 is arranged on the surface of each rolling shaft 102, a magnet 105 is fixedly connected to the surface of each conveying belt 104, a fixing frame 106 is fixedly connected to the upper side of the rack 101, a pressure pump 107 and a material box 108 are fixedly connected to the upper side of the fixing frame 106, a positioning plate 109 is fixedly connected to the inner part of the fixing frame 106, a pipeline 110 is fixedly connected to the upper side of the positioning plate 109, and a spray head 111 is connected to the lower side of the positioning plate 109 through threads;
the auxiliary mechanism 2 comprises a supporting frame 201, a fan 202 is fixedly connected below the supporting frame 201, and a hairbrush 203 is arranged on the left side of the supporting frame 201.
Through the technical scheme, through placing the high rigidity clipboard on multiunit magnet 105 top surface, multiunit magnet 105 can adsorb fixed high rigidity clipboard, the rotation of motor 103 drives roller bearing 102 and rotates together, then move multiunit magnet 105 and the high rigidity clipboard that drives conveyer belt 104 top and move to the right, sweep the dust on high rigidity clipboard surface through brush 203, then reach two sets of shower nozzles 111 below and carry out the spraying to the high rigidity clipboard of conveyer belt 104 top, reach two sets of fans 202 below at last and dry the high rigidity clipboard that the spraying finishes, reach fixed high rigidity clipboard, improve the effect of spraying effect.
Specifically, the front and rear inner walls of the left side above the frame 101 are fixedly connected with a brush 203, and the right side above the frame 101 is fixedly connected with the lower part of the supporting frame 201.
Through above-mentioned technical scheme, inner wall fixed connection brush 203 around frame 101 top left side, frame 101 top right side fixed connection support frame 201 below sweeps the dust on high rigidity clipboard surface through brush 203, reaches the effect of clearance.
Specifically, there are two sets of rollers 102, and the rear end of the motor 103 is fixedly connected to the front end of the left roller 102.
Through the technical scheme, the number of the rollers 102 is two, the rear end of the motor 103 is fixedly connected with the front end of the roller 102 positioned on the left side, the motor 103 is internally provided with the prior art, the roller 102 is driven to rotate together by the rotation of the motor 103, and then the conveyer belt 104 is driven to move rightwards, so that the transmission effect is achieved.
Specifically, there are multiple sets of magnets 105, and the multiple sets of magnets 105 are fixedly attached to the upper and lower surfaces of the conveyor belt 104 in a rectangular array.
Through above-mentioned technical scheme, magnet 105 has the multiunit, and multiunit magnet 105 is according to rectangle array fixed connection on conveyer belt 104 below surface, through placing the high rigidity clipboard on multiunit magnet 105 top surface, multiunit magnet 105 can adsorb fixed high rigidity clipboard, then conveyer belt 104 drives multiunit magnet 105 and high rigidity clipboard and moves right, reaches shower nozzle 111 below, reaches firm effect.
Specifically, the pressure pump 107 and the tank 108 are connected with each other, and the pressure pump 107 is movably connected above the pipeline 110.
Through the technical scheme, the pressure pump 107 and the feed box 108 are connected with each other, the pressure pump 107 is movably connected above the pipeline 110, the interior of the pressure pump 107 is the prior art, and the coating in the feed box 108 is conveyed to the interior of the spray head 111 by turning on the pressure pump 107.
Specifically, two sets of circular holes are formed in the positioning plate 109, the spray heads 111 are provided in two sets, and the two sets of spray heads 111 are in threaded connection with the two sets of circular holes formed in the positioning plate 109.
Through above-mentioned technical scheme, two sets of circular ports have been seted up to locating plate 109 inside, and shower nozzle 111 has two sets ofly, and two sets of shower nozzles 111 top threaded connection locating plate 109 are inside to be seted up two sets of circular ports, fixes a position two sets of shower nozzles 111 through locating plate 109, then carries out the spraying to the high rigidity clipboard of conveyer belt 104 top.
Specifically, there are two sets of fans 202, and the lower surface of the brush 203 contacts the upper surface of the magnet 105.
Through above-mentioned technical scheme, fan 202 has two sets ofly, and brush 203 lower surface and magnet 105 upper surface contact dry the high rigidity clipboard that the spraying finishes through two sets of fans 202, set up the dust that brush 203 conveniently brushed the high rigidity clipboard top, make can not lead to the high rigidity clipboard to damage at the spraying in-process because of the foreign matter.
When the high-hardness writing board spraying device is used, the high-hardness writing board is placed on the surface above the plurality of groups of magnets 105, the plurality of groups of magnets 105 can adsorb and fix the high-hardness writing board, the motor 103 rotates to drive the roller 102 to rotate together, then the plurality of groups of magnets 105 and the high-hardness writing board above the conveying belt 104 are driven to move rightwards, the dust on the surface of the high-hardness writing board is swept through the hairbrush 203, then the high-hardness writing board above the conveying belt 104 is sprayed below the two groups of nozzles 111, and finally the high-hardness writing board after being sprayed is dried below the two groups of fans 202, so that the high-hardness writing board is fixed, and the spraying effect is improved.
